Change of shareholders at Betonbau Group

01. Mär 2022

After more than 15 successful years as part of the SCHWENK Group, funds advised by capiton AG acquire a majority stake in the Betonbau Group retroactively as of 01.01.2021.

The two managing directors of the Betonbau Group, Mr. Volker Ernst and Mr. Thomas Sachers, will also participate in the company within the framework of a management buy-out and will continue to exercise their function as managing directors.

The new majority owner, Berlin-based capiton AG, is a German investment company that has been investing in high-growth, medium-sized companies in the German-speaking region for more than 30 years, supporting them professionally and with commitment in order to achieve long-term and sustainable corporate success. In doing so, capiton AG sees itself as a co-entrepreneur who supports the management in realizing the common vision and thus leading the Betonbau Group into a promising future.

Christoph Spors, Partner at capiton, expects great things: "We are pleased to be a partner of Betonbau, a true hidden champion with a strong technological footprint. Betonbau will be a key player in the energy transition, benefiting from the long-term growth in energy demand, which will come, for example, from the booming electromobility market and the replacement of fossil fuels with electrical energy. Betonbau's intelligent transformer stations will play a decisive role in the nationwide supply of households with conventional and decentralized green electricity."

Now the company is looking forward to the next stage of its history: "In recent years, together with our employees and a change in culture, we have succeeded in developing Betonbau into the clear market leader for turnkey technical buildings. We look forward to continuing this strong growth path through further geographic expansion and the development of new, high-growth segments as well as inorganic growth. With capiton we have found a strong financial partner to accelerate this growth strategy," said Volker Ernst and Thomas Sachers.
